Job
Description
Role Overview: As a Senior SDET Lead at a major telecommunications company, you will be responsible for designing and implementing robust test frameworks, leading test automation strategies, and ensuring seamless integration of automated tests into CI/CD pipelines. Your critical role will involve end-to-end testing of frontend and backend components, including web UI and RESTful APIs. You will collaborate with data scientists, ML engineers, and data engineers to ensure model testability, reproducibility, and alignment with business goals. Key Responsibilities: - Design, develop, and execute manual and automated test cases for UI, REST APIs, and data pipelines across platforms like Databricks, ADF, and Snowflake. - Perform data validation at all stages including input datasets, transformation logic, model features, predictions, and outputs to ensure accuracy and consistency. - Develop test automation scripts in Python for validating data workflows and machine learning model outputs. - Conduct API testing using tools such as Advanced REST Client, Postman, or similar, and troubleshoot using browser console and developer tools. - Define comprehensive software testing strategies encompassing functional, performance, regression, and security testing. - Maintain a robust suite of test cases to fully validate code functionality and performance. - Evaluate and adapt test automation tools to support evolving project needs and optimize testing efforts. - Participate actively in Agile ceremonies and contribute to the continuous improvement of testing practices. - Mentor junior team members and contribute to the evolution of best practices in quality engineering. - Conduct threat analysis, prioritize vulnerabilities, provide remediation guidance, and validate the effectiveness of applied fixes. - Perform regression testing during deployment cycles to ensure system stability and backward compatibility. Qualification Required: - Bachelor's degree in Computer Science or related field. - 3-6 years of experience as an SDET, QA Automation Engineer, or related role. - Experience in leading and mentoring a team of QA engineers. - Strong proficiency in Java and hands-on experience with Selenium WebDriver. - Experience with unit testing and test frameworks such as TestNG or JUnit. - Solid experience with REST API testing using Postman and RestAssured. - Automated Testing with Python (PyTest) for APIs, data pipelines, and ML models. - Experience integrating automated tests into CI/CD pipelines. - Experience with performance testing tools such as JMeter or Gatling. - Strong debugging and troubleshooting skills. - Familiarity with containerized environments like Docker and Kubernetes. - Familiarity with BDD frameworks such as Cucumber. - Exposure to cloud platforms like AWS, Azure, or GCP. - Working knowledge of SQL for data validation. - ISTQB or equivalent QA certification is a plus. Additional Details: GlobalLogic, a Hitachi Group Company, is a trusted digital engineering partner known for creating innovative digital products and experiences. They collaborate with clients to transform businesses through intelligent products, platforms, and services. At GlobalLogic, you will experience a culture of caring, learning, interesting work, balance, flexibility, and integrity.,